package org.alfresco.repo.domain.encoding;
import java.io.Serializable;
import org.alfresco.error.AlfrescoRuntimeException;
import org.alfresco.repo.cache.SimpleCache;
import org.alfresco.util.Pair;
import org.alfresco.util.ParameterCheck;
/**
 * Abstract implementation for Encoding DAO.
 * 
 * This provides basic services such as caching, but defers to the underlying implementation
 * for CRUD operations. 
 * 
 * @author Derek Hulley
 * @since 3.2
 */
public abstract class AbstractEncodingDAOImpl implements EncodingDAO
{
    private static final Long CACHE_NULL_LONG = Long.MIN_VALUE;
    private SimpleCache encodingEntityCache;
    /**
     * 
     * @param encodingEntityCache           the cache of IDs to mimetypes
     */
    public void setEncodingEntityCache(SimpleCache encodingEntityCache)
    {
        this.encodingEntityCache = encodingEntityCache;
    }
    public Pair getEncoding(Long id)
    {
        // Check the cache
        String encoding = (String) encodingEntityCache.get(id);
        if (encoding != null)
        {
            return new Pair(id, encoding);
        }
        // Get it from the DB
        EncodingEntity mimetypeEntity = getEncodingEntity(id);
        if (mimetypeEntity == null)
        {
            throw new AlfrescoRuntimeException("The MimetypeEntity ID " + id + " doesn't exist.");
        }
        encoding = mimetypeEntity.getEncoding();
        // Cache it
        encodingEntityCache.put(encoding, id);
        encodingEntityCache.put(id, encoding);
        // Done
        return new Pair(id, encoding);
    }
    public Pair getEncoding(String encoding)
    {
        ParameterCheck.mandatory("encoding", encoding);
        
        // Check the cache
        Long id = (Long) encodingEntityCache.get(encoding);
        if (id != null)
        {
            if (id.equals(CACHE_NULL_LONG))
            {
                return null;
            }
            else
            {
                return new Pair(id, encoding);
            }
        }
        // It's not in the cache, so query
        EncodingEntity result = getEncodingEntity(encoding);
        if (result == null)
        {
            // Cache it
            encodingEntityCache.put(encoding, CACHE_NULL_LONG);
            // Done
            return null;
        }
        else
        {
            id = result.getId();
            // Cache it
            encodingEntityCache.put(id, encoding);
            encodingEntityCache.put(encoding, id);
            // Done
            return new Pair(id, encoding);
        }
    }
    public Pair getOrCreateEncoding(String encoding)
    {
        ParameterCheck.mandatory("encoding", encoding);
        
        Pair result = getEncoding(encoding);
        if (result == null)
        {
            EncodingEntity encodingEntity = createEncodingEntity(encoding);
            Long id = encodingEntity.getId();
            result = new Pair(id, encoding);
            // Cache it
            encodingEntityCache.put(id, encoding);
            encodingEntityCache.put(encoding, id);
        }
        return result;
    }
    
    /**
     * @param id            the ID of the encoding entity
     * @return              Return the entity or null if it doesn't exist
     */
    protected abstract EncodingEntity getEncodingEntity(Long id);
    protected abstract EncodingEntity getEncodingEntity(String encoding);
    protected abstract EncodingEntity createEncodingEntity(String encoding);
}
